Record Size Measurements and Verification

When identifying the world's largest spider ever found, researchers prioritize standardized measurements. Leg span, body length, and weight are recorded using calipers and published in peer-reviewed journals. Claims based on photographs without physical verification are treated skeptically.

Spiders are measured with legs fully extended for span and along the body for length. Weight is obtained when possible, though many giants are reported without mass data. Reliable sources include museum collections and published field studies.

Goliath Birdeater as the Heaviest Spider

The Goliath Birdeater often holds the title of heaviest spider. Native to northern South America, females can exceed 170 grams in the wild. Despite the name, birds are rarely part of their diet, but large insects, worms, and small vertebrates are common prey.

Its fangs can exceed 2 centimeters, and defensive urticating hairs can irritate predators and humans. This species demonstrates how size influences thermoregulation and molting frequency in tarantulas.

Giant Huntsman Spider Leg Span Records

The Giant Huntsman spider, discovered in a Laotian cave, holds the record for longest leg span. Its leg span reaches approximately 30 cm, while its body remains relatively slender. The flattened body aids movement in cave environments.

This species lacks a dense covering of urticating hairs and relies on speed and venom to subvert insects and other arthropods. Its discovery underscored the importance of cave biodiversity in Southeast Asia.

How is the size of the largest spider scientifically measured?

Measurements are taken of leg span with legs fully extended, body length from head to abdomen, and weight when feasible, using digital calipers and standardized protocols in arachnology labs.

Are unverified online photos reliable evidence of giant spiders?

Photos without context, scale, or expert confirmation are often exaggerated; peer-reviewed records and museum specimens provide the most credible size data.

What environmental factors influence maximum spider size?

Temperature, prey availability, habitat stability, and molting conditions affect growth, with tropical regions generally supporting larger species due to consistent resources and year-round activity.

Do larger spiders face higher risks from habitat loss and collection?

Large, slow-reproducing species like tarantulas are vulnerable to deforestation, cave disturbance, and overcollection for trade, making conservation crucial for maintaining genetic diversity.
